摘要
采用三维有限元法对套管叉锻件热挤压成形过程进行了数值模拟仿真分析。针对其成形过程中出现的叉部顶端及底端充不满现象进行了深入分析,提出了防止缺陷产生的一种特殊的凸模结构。生产实践表明,采用这种特殊的凸模结构后,可达到降低材料消耗、提高模具使用寿命、提高产品尺寸精度和力学性能等效果。
D FEM has been employed to analyze and simulate numerically the process of hot extrusion of transmis-sion shaft forgings with deep research of phenomena of top and bottom of fork that not completely filled in the form-ing process hence an especial punch die structure preventing the defects been developed.Practical production has shown good effects such as reduction of material consumption,longer service life of die,higher dimensional accuracy and better mechanical properties when using this structure.
